Part 29 - PEPPER WEEVIL INTERIOR QUARANTINE AND PLOW-DOWN
Section 21.17.29.6 - OBJECTIVE

Universal Citation: 21 NM Admin Code 21.17.29.6
Current through Register Vol. 35, No. 6, March 26, 2024

The objective of Part 29 of Chapter 17 is to establish cultural control practices for the pepper weevil in order to protect the New Mexico sweet and chile pepper industry from this injurious pest.
